How do I transfer property from one person to another in Ohio?
To transfer title, you must deliver the executed and acknowledged deed to the grantee. This means that you must give up control over the deed during your lifetime and intend to transfer title to the grantee. To complete the transfer, the grantee must accept the delivered deed.

Who pays the deed transfer tax in PA?
Pennsylvania realty transfer tax is imposed at a rate of 1 percent on the value of real estate (including contracted-for improvements to property) transferred by deed, instrument, long-term lease or other writing. Both grantor and grantee are held jointly and severally liable for payment of the tax.

How much does it cost to transfer a deed in Oklahoma?
How Much Are Transfer Taxes in Oklahoma? In Oklahoma, the documentary stamps are $0.75 per $500 (or 0.15%) of the sales price of the property. For median value homes in Oklahoma worth $123,700, the transfer tax would be $185.55. The documentary stamps are affixed to the deed when it is recorded.

How do I add my spouse to my house deed in Oklahoma?
How do I add my spouse to my house deed in Oklahoma? You will need to have the quitclaim deed docHubd with the signatures of you and your spouse. Once this is done, the quitclaim deed replaces your former deed and the property officially is in both of your names. You must record the deed at your county office.
